一、词汇的多重含义
-
词汇的多义性
自然语言中的词汇往往具有多重含义,这是歧义性的主要来源之一。例如,英文单词“bank”既可以指“银行”,也可以指“河岸”。这种多义性在特定上下文中可能会导致理解上的混淆。 -
同音异义词
同音异义词是指发音相同但意义不同的词汇。例如,中文中的“他”和“她”在发音上完全相同,但在书面语中却有不同的含义。这种同音异义词在口语交流中尤其容易引发歧义。 -
解决方案
为了减少词汇多义性带来的歧义,可以通过上下文分析、语义网络和机器学习算法来辅助理解。例如,自然语言处理(NLP)技术可以通过分析上下文来确定词汇的具体含义。
二、语法结构的复杂性
-
句法歧义
语法结构的复杂性是自然语言歧义性的另一个重要来源。例如,句子“我看见了一个拿着望远镜的女孩”可以有两种理解:一种是“我”拿着望远镜,另一种是“女孩”拿着望远镜。 -
长句和复杂句
长句和复杂句由于其结构复杂,往往更容易产生歧义。例如,复合句中的从句和主句之间的关系可能不明确,导致理解上的困难。 -
解决方案
通过语法分析和句法树构建,可以更好地理解句子的结构。此外,使用简化和标准化的句子结构也可以减少歧义。
三、上下文依赖性
-
上下文的重要性
自然语言的理解高度依赖于上下文。例如,句子“他去了银行”在没有上下文的情况下,无法确定“银行”是指金融机构还是河岸。 -
上下文缺失
在缺乏足够上下文的情况下,歧义性会显著增加。例如,在短信或即时通讯中,由于信息量有限,往往需要更多的上下文来准确理解信息。 -
解决方案
通过上下文分析和语境建模,可以提高理解的准确性。例如,使用上下文感知的NLP模型,可以更好地捕捉和理解上下文信息。
四、文化与背景知识的影响
-
文化差异
不同文化背景下的语言使用习惯和表达方式可能存在显著差异。例如,某些成语或俚语在一种文化中可能具有特定的含义,而在另一种文化中则可能完全不同。 -
背景知识
背景知识的差异也会影响语言的理解。例如,专业术语在特定领域内具有特定的含义,但对于非专业人士来说,这些术语可能难以理解。 -
解决方案
通过跨文化沟通培训和背景知识共享,可以减少文化和背景知识差异带来的歧义。此外,使用多语言和多文化适应的NLP模型,也可以提高理解的准确性。
五、语音语调的变化对理解的影响
-
语音语调的作用
语音语调在口语交流中起着至关重要的作用。例如,同一个句子在不同的语调下可能表达完全不同的情感和意图。 -
语音歧义
语音歧义是指由于语音语调的变化导致的歧义。例如,句子“你真的要去吗?”在不同的语调下,可能表达疑问、惊讶或讽刺等不同的情感。 -
解决方案
通过语音识别和情感分析技术,可以更好地理解和处理语音语调的变化。此外,使用语音合成技术,可以模拟不同的语音语调,提高交流的准确性。
六、隐喻和比喻语言的使用
-
隐喻和比喻的作用
隐喻和比喻是自然语言中常见的修辞手法,它们通过类比和象征来表达复杂的概念和情感。例如,“时间就是金钱”通过隐喻表达了时间的宝贵。 -
隐喻歧义
隐喻和比喻的使用往往会导致歧义,因为它们依赖于特定的文化背景和语境。例如,某些隐喻在一种文化中可能具有特定的含义,而在另一种文化中则可能完全不同。 -
解决方案
通过隐喻识别和解释技术,可以更好地理解和处理隐喻和比喻语言。此外,使用多语言和多文化适应的NLP模型,也可以提高理解的准确性。
总结
自然语言的歧义性主要来源于词汇的多重含义、语法结构的复杂性、上下文依赖性、文化与背景知识的影响、语音语调的变化以及隐喻和比喻语言的使用。通过上下文分析、语法分析、语音识别、情感分析、隐喻识别和跨文化沟通等技术手段,可以有效减少自然语言中的歧义性,提高理解和交流的准确性。
原创文章,作者:IamI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/165684